Slash, the iconic, Grammy-winning rock guitarist and songwriter has revealed the cover artwork and album title for his second studio album, 'Apocalyptic Love'. Due out May 21st in the UK, the new album features Myles Kennedy and The Conspirators and will be released on Slash's own label DikHayd International and distributed through Roadrunner Records in Europe, Middle East, and Africa.

Slash is currently in a Los Angeles studio putting the final touches on 'Apocalyptic Love'. This week he announced his headlining U.S. tour will begin May 3rd in Baltimore. Tickets are on sale now.
'Apocalyptic Love' will follow his 2010 debut album, 'Slash', which has now sold over 100,000 copies in the UK alone, and his November 2011 first-ever live solo album, the two-CD/DVD set 'Made In Stoke 24/7/11'. Notably, the Slash album debuted on the Billboard Top 200 chart at #3 (#1 on the Rock chart, #1 on the Independent chart, and #1 on the Hard Music chart).
Digitally, the album also became the #1 overall digital album and hit #1 on iTunes in 13 countries. Internationally, the disc achieved Top 5 chart positions in over a dozen major territories, hitting #1 in both Japan and New Zealand.
On 'Apocalyptic Love' Slash, along with his bandmates Myles Kennedy (vocals), Brent Fitz (drums) and Todd Kerns (bass), have teamed with producer Eric Valentine, who also produced the Slash disc.
